Homes in Uvalde County have sold for 4.6% less than they did a year ago.

Summary: The median home sold price in Uvalde County was $229,000 in April 2024, down 4.6% from last year, and the median price per square foot was $139.

Summary: Uvalde County housing prices by bedroom type for April 2024 compared to the previous year: The home price of 1 bedroom homes decreased by 32.4%, 2 bedroom homes decreased by 5.2%, 3 bedroom homes increased by 5.5%, 4 bedroom homes decreased by 6.4%, and 5+ bedroom homes decreased by 15.5%.

If you're buying a home in Uvalde County, you may be able to get a good deal. 75% of homes here sold below asking price last month.

Summary: A total of 20 homes were sold or pending in Uvalde County in April 2024, up by 53.8% month-over-month. Of the 20 sold homes, 75% were sold under asking, 15% were sold at asking, and 10% were sold over asking.

Summary: Homes in Uvalde County had an average of 99 days on market in Apr 2024, up by 76.4% compared to last year.

Summary: During April 2024, 20 homes were sold in Uvalde County; 35% of homes were sold within 30 days, 35% of homes were sold within 30 to 90 days, and 30% of homes were sold over 90 days.
